Position Summary : An MCA Manager is responsible for assisting the GM in all day-to-day restaurant operations. This may include BOH and FOH hiring, supervisor / employee development and training, performance documentation, adequate staffing, adherence to all MCA policies and procedures, food quality and presentation, sanitation, safety and responsibility for tracking revenues and cash accounts. Responsible for ensuring the highest level of customer service throughout the operation. Being a role model / leader with the ability to solve problems, make informed decisions and manage the workforce and time wisely to achieve maximum results.
